单项选择题
对下述程序的判断中,正确的是
void main()
char*p,s[128];
p=s;
while(strcmp(s,"End"))
printf("Input a string:");
gets(s);
while(*p)
putchar(*p++);
A) 此程序循环接收字符串并输出,直到接收字符串"End"为止
B) 此程序循环接收字符串,接收到字符串"End"则输出,否则程序终止
C) 此程序循环接收字符串并输出,直到接收字符串"End"为止,但因为代码有错误,程序不能正常工作
D) 此程序循环接收字符串并将其连接在一起,直到接收字符串"End"为止,输出连接在一起的字符串
点击查看答案&解析
<上一题
目录
下一题>
热门
试题
单项选择题
运行以下程序后,如果从键盘上输入65 14<回车>,则输出结果为()。 main() int m,n; printf( Enter m,n: ); scanf( %d%d ,&m,&n); while(m!=n) while(m>n)m-=n; while(n>m)n-=m; printf( m=%d n ,m);
A. m=3
B. m=2
C. m=1
D. m=0
点击查看答案&解析
单项选择题
若已定义的函数有返回值,则以下关于该函数调用的叙述中错误的是( )。
A) 函数调用可以作为独立的语句存在
B) 函数调用可以作为一个函数的实参
C) 函数调用可以出现在表达式中
D) 函数调用可以作为一个函数的形参
点击查看答案&解析
相关试题
在对下列函数调用中,不正确的是()
有以下程序fun(char p[][10]) in...
下面关于完全二叉树的叙述中,错误的是()。
有以下程序main ( ){ char a,b,c...
下列程序的输出结果是()。 #include<s...